Package oracle.jdbc
Enum DatabaseFunction
- java.lang.Object
-
- java.lang.Enum<DatabaseFunction>
-
- oracle.jdbc.DatabaseFunction
-
- All Implemented Interfaces:
java.io.Serializable
,java.lang.Comparable<DatabaseFunction>
public enum DatabaseFunction extends java.lang.Enum<DatabaseFunction>
Database operation/function enumeration.
-
-
Enum Constant Summary
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description short
getCode()
Gets the database function code.java.lang.String
getDescription()
Gets the database function description.static DatabaseFunction
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.static DatabaseFunction
valueOfFunctionCode(short code)
Gets the DatabaseFunction by function codestatic DatabaseFunction[]
values()
Returns an array containing the constants of this enum type, in the order they are declared.
-
-
-
Enum Constant Detail
-
OPEN_CURSOR
public static final DatabaseFunction OPEN_CURSOR
-
FETCH_ROW
public static final DatabaseFunction FETCH_ROW
-
CLOSE_CURSOR
public static final DatabaseFunction CLOSE_CURSOR
-
LOGOFF
public static final DatabaseFunction LOGOFF
-
AUTO_COMMIT_ON
public static final DatabaseFunction AUTO_COMMIT_ON
-
AUTO_COMMIT_OFF
public static final DatabaseFunction AUTO_COMMIT_OFF
-
COMMIT
public static final DatabaseFunction COMMIT
-
ROLLBACK
public static final DatabaseFunction ROLLBACK
-
CANCEL_OPERATION
public static final DatabaseFunction CANCEL_OPERATION
-
DESCRIBE_ARRAY
public static final DatabaseFunction DESCRIBE_ARRAY
-
GET_VERSION
public static final DatabaseFunction GET_VERSION
-
OSTART
public static final DatabaseFunction OSTART
-
OSTOP
public static final DatabaseFunction OSTOP
-
DISTRIBUTED_TRANS_MGR_RPC
public static final DatabaseFunction DISTRIBUTED_TRANS_MGR_RPC
-
FAST_UPI_CALLS
public static final DatabaseFunction FAST_UPI_CALLS
-
OSQL7
public static final DatabaseFunction OSQL7
-
OEXFEN
public static final DatabaseFunction OEXFEN
-
LOGON_CHALLENGE_RESPONSE_2
public static final DatabaseFunction LOGON_CHALLENGE_RESPONSE_2
-
LOGON_CHALLENGE_RESPONSE_1
public static final DatabaseFunction LOGON_CHALLENGE_RESPONSE_1
-
EXECUTE_QUERY
public static final DatabaseFunction EXECUTE_QUERY
-
LOB_FILE_CALL
public static final DatabaseFunction LOB_FILE_CALL
-
DESCRIBE_QUERY_CALL
public static final DatabaseFunction DESCRIBE_QUERY_CALL
-
TRANSACTION_START
public static final DatabaseFunction TRANSACTION_START
-
TRANSACTION_COMMIT
public static final DatabaseFunction TRANSACTION_COMMIT
-
CLOSE_ALL_CURSOR
public static final DatabaseFunction CLOSE_ALL_CURSOR
-
SESSION_SWITCH_V8
public static final DatabaseFunction SESSION_SWITCH_V8
-
DESCRIBE_ANY_V8
public static final DatabaseFunction DESCRIBE_ANY_V8
-
AUTH_CALL
public static final DatabaseFunction AUTH_CALL
-
SESSION_KEY
public static final DatabaseFunction SESSION_KEY
-
CANCEL_ALL
public static final DatabaseFunction CANCEL_ALL
-
KERNEL_PROGRAMMATIC_NOTIFICATION
public static final DatabaseFunction KERNEL_PROGRAMMATIC_NOTIFICATION
-
TRACING_MESSAGE
public static final DatabaseFunction TRACING_MESSAGE
-
PARAMETER_PUT_SPFILE
public static final DatabaseFunction PARAMETER_PUT_SPFILE
-
PING
public static final DatabaseFunction PING
-
KEY_VALUE
public static final DatabaseFunction KEY_VALUE
-
EXTENSIBLE_SECURITY_SESSION_CREATE
public static final DatabaseFunction EXTENSIBLE_SECURITY_SESSION_CREATE
-
EXTENSIBLE_SECURITY_SESSION_ROUNDTRIP
public static final DatabaseFunction EXTENSIBLE_SECURITY_SESSION_ROUNDTRIP
-
EXTENSIBLE_SECURITY_SESSION_PIGGYBACK
public static final DatabaseFunction EXTENSIBLE_SECURITY_SESSION_PIGGYBACK
-
ADVANCED_QUEUING_ENQUEUE
public static final DatabaseFunction ADVANCED_QUEUING_ENQUEUE
-
ADVANCED_QUEUING_DEQUEUE_V8
public static final DatabaseFunction ADVANCED_QUEUING_DEQUEUE_V8
-
ADVANCED_QUEUING_GET_PROPAGATION_STATUS
public static final DatabaseFunction ADVANCED_QUEUING_GET_PROPAGATION_STATUS
-
ADVANCED_QUEUING_LISTEN
public static final DatabaseFunction ADVANCED_QUEUING_LISTEN
-
ADVANCED_QUEUING_ARRAY_ENQUEUE_DEQUEUE
public static final DatabaseFunction ADVANCED_QUEUING_ARRAY_ENQUEUE_DEQUEUE
-
ADVANCED_QUEUING_SESSION_GET_RPC_1
public static final DatabaseFunction ADVANCED_QUEUING_SESSION_GET_RPC_1
-
ADVANCED_QUEUING_SESSION_GET_RPC_2
public static final DatabaseFunction ADVANCED_QUEUING_SESSION_GET_RPC_2
-
SESSION_STATE_TEMPLATE
public static final DatabaseFunction SESSION_STATE_TEMPLATE
-
CLIENT_QUERY_CACHE_STATS_UPDATE
public static final DatabaseFunction CLIENT_QUERY_CACHE_STATS_UPDATE
-
CLIENT_QUERY_CACHE_IDS
public static final DatabaseFunction CLIENT_QUERY_CACHE_IDS
-
XS_NAMESPACE_OPS
public static final DatabaseFunction XS_NAMESPACE_OPS
-
XS_NAMESPACE_OP
public static final DatabaseFunction XS_NAMESPACE_OP
-
XS_STATE_SYNC_OP
public static final DatabaseFunction XS_STATE_SYNC_OP
-
XS_ATTACH_SESSION
public static final DatabaseFunction XS_ATTACH_SESSION
-
XS_CREATE_SESSION
public static final DatabaseFunction XS_CREATE_SESSION
-
XS_DETACH_SESSION
public static final DatabaseFunction XS_DETACH_SESSION
-
XS_DESTROY_SESSION
public static final DatabaseFunction XS_DESTROY_SESSION
-
XS_SET_SESSION_PARAMETER
public static final DatabaseFunction XS_SET_SESSION_PARAMETER
-
SESSION_STATE_OPS
public static final DatabaseFunction SESSION_STATE_OPS
-
APP_REPLAY
public static final DatabaseFunction APP_REPLAY
-
ADVANCED_QUEUING_SHARED_ENQUEUE
public static final DatabaseFunction ADVANCED_QUEUING_SHARED_ENQUEUE
-
ADVANCED_QUEUING_SHARED_DEQUEUE
public static final DatabaseFunction ADVANCED_QUEUING_SHARED_DEQUEUE
-
ADVANCED_QUEUING_12C_EMON_DEQUEUE
public static final DatabaseFunction ADVANCED_QUEUING_12C_EMON_DEQUEUE
-
DB12C_NOTIFICATION_RCV
public static final DatabaseFunction DB12C_NOTIFICATION_RCV
-
CHUNCK_INFO
public static final DatabaseFunction CHUNCK_INFO
-
CLIENT_FEATURES
public static final DatabaseFunction CLIENT_FEATURES
-
DBNS_SAGAS
public static final DatabaseFunction DBNS_SAGAS
-
DIRECT_PATH_PREPARE
public static final DatabaseFunction DIRECT_PATH_PREPARE
-
DIRECT_PATH_MISC_OP
public static final DatabaseFunction DIRECT_PATH_MISC_OP
-
DIRECT_PATH_LOAD_STREAM
public static final DatabaseFunction DIRECT_PATH_LOAD_STREAM
-
PIPELINE_PIGGYBACK_BEGIN
public static final DatabaseFunction PIPELINE_PIGGYBACK_BEGIN
-
PIPELINE_END
public static final DatabaseFunction PIPELINE_END
-
PIPELINE_PIGGYBACK_OP
public static final DatabaseFunction PIPELINE_PIGGYBACK_OP
-
TTC_DTY_ROUNDTRIP
public static final DatabaseFunction TTC_DTY_ROUNDTRIP
-
TTC_PRO_ROUNDTRIP
public static final DatabaseFunction TTC_PRO_ROUNDTRIP
-
-
Method Detail
-
values
public static DatabaseFunction[] values()
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:for (DatabaseFunction c : DatabaseFunction.values()) System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in the order they are declared
-
valueOf
public static DatabaseFunction val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
name
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is null
-
valueOfFunctionCode
public static DatabaseFunction valueOfFunctionCode(short code)
Gets the DatabaseFunction by function code- Parameters:
code
- the database function code- Returns:
- the matching DatabaseFunction
-
getCode
public short getCode()
Gets the database function code.- Returns:
- the code
-
getDescription
public java.lang.String getDescription()
Gets the database function description.- Returns:
- the description
-
-